Write a 'why I quit' essay
Drafts an essay about quitting something — a job, project, or commitment — with honesty.

Updates live as you typeYou are an essayist. Write a 'why I quit {{what}}' essay (~900 words) by {{author}}. Inputs — what you did: {{what_you_did}}, why you started: {{why_started}}, the moment you knew: {{moment}}, what you lost: {{lost}}, what you gained: {{gained}}. Structure: (1) opening scene of the moment you knew, (2) why you started in the first place (no judgement of past you), (3) the slow build-up of the decision, (4) the actual quit (what you did, what you said), (5) the immediate aftermath, (6) what you lost honestly, (7) what you gained, (8) what you'd say to someone in the same place now. Plain English.Run in
